Output 8112769ec19ffa44daa2c4a83e4a23fc8d5a6d9f20ee2727c87627f367649304:4

value
7623851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ffc1689b1f94878f00e08d3c35d81141b37b8651 OP_EQUAL
address
3R1Kvj7EfbpUq711AvKrNXimmkrhYNLxjn
transaction
8112769ec19ffa44daa2c4a83e4a23fc8d5a6d9f20ee2727c87627f367649304
spent
true